HomeMy WebLinkAbout622 Use Of City Water ( OR'GiNAL ORDINANCE NO. 62.2 A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Y OF MERIDIAN AMENDING CHAPTER 1, TITLE 5, OF THE REVISED AND COMPILED ORDINANCES OF THE CITY OF MERIDIAN BY THE ADDITION THERETO OF A NEW SECTION TO BE KNOWN AS 5-104A, REQUIRED USE OF CITY WATER, AND PROVIDING AN EFFECTIVE DATE. WHEREAS, the Mayor and the City Council of the City of Meridian, State of Idaho, have concluded that it is in the best interest of the said City to further state when City water is required to be used and when connection to City water is required, N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E MAYOR AND C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F MERIDIAN, ADA COUNTY, IDAHO: SECTION 1: That Chapter 1, Title 5 of the Revised and Compiled Ordinances of the City of Meridian is hereby amended by the addition thereto of a new section to be known as 5-104A, REQUIRED USE OF CITY WATER which shall read as follows: 5-104A: REQUIRED USE OF CITY WATER: The owner or occupant of any house, building or property used for residential, commercial, industrial, governmental or recreational use, or other purpose, situated within the City which is abutting on or having a permanent right of access to any street, alley or right of way in which there is located a City water line of said City is hereby required to cease using any other water system and at his expense to connect such building directly with the city water in accordance with the provisions of this Chapter, within fifteen (15) calendar days after the date of official notice from the City to do so, provided, however, that said City water is within three hundred (300') of any property line where said building to be served is located. At such time as the municipal water system becomes available to the property served by the private water system, and the owner or tenant connects his property to municipal service as required, it is mandatory that the private water supply is not connected or cross connected in any way to the water lines served by the municipal water system. The dis- connection of the private water supply line shall be inspected and approved by the Waterworks Superintendent or his designated representative.
